Energy Distribution ofγRays fromπ0Decay

Abstract
It is shown that the γ-ray energy distribution resulting from the decay of π0 mesons produced in a target bombarded by a high-energy particle beam is related in a simple manner to the differential π0 production cross section, for sufficiently high energies of the γ's (≳500 Mev). An expression is obtained for the π0 production cross section in terms of the γ-ray energy distribution. This result is extended to the case of an arbitrary two-body decay, for which an expression is obtained for the production cross section of the primaries in terms of the energy distribution of the secondaries emitted in the decay.
